The U.S. seized one of North Korea's largest bulk carrier vessels for allegedly shipping illicit coal and heavy machinery in violation of U.S. and UN sanctions. The seizure of the North Korean bulk carrier ship "Wise Honest" is the first such action against a North Korean cargo vessel. According to the DOJ, the ship's operators allegedly employed sanctions-evading tactics including the deactivation of its automatic identification system in order to avoid tracking. OFAC and other agencies had highlighted this and other tactics in a November 2018 Advisory to the Maritime Petroleum Shipping Community.
